I am trying to get my motherboard to read my flash drive, but numerous attempts have failed and my motherboard just flat out won't recognize it. My motherboard is Gigabyte GA-Z68XP-UD3P Rev 1.0, BIOS version F7 running Intel Core i5-3450. Plugging in numerous USB devices and even my phone have caused the USB ports to report "device has malfunctioned" errors despite that they worked perfectly before I reformatted my drive. But I have also been attempting to install the Intel INF controller and the original USB 3.0 drivers that came with the motherboard only to have the driver installation program report errors. The system device manager lists all the devices working perfectly, but attempts to plug in new devices will cause the system to not recognize these drives. It also reports the SM Bus Controller as having a missing driver. What is going on here? Is this a motherboard problem or a driver problem?
